DTTE Releases CET Delhi 2019 Admit Card at cetdelhi.nic.in; Check Steps to Download Admit Card

by Ginni Tyagi
May 29, 2019
in Uncategorized
Reading Time: 2 mins read
CET-Delhi-2019-Admit-Card-Released-Aglasem

Department of Training and Technical Education (DTTE) has released the Delhi CET Polytechnic Admit Card 2019 on May 29, 2019. The admit card has been released online at cetdelhi.nic.in at the Candidate login.

To download the Delhi CET 2019 Admit Card, the candidates need to visit the official website of CET Delhi. On the homepage of the website, the candidates need to click on the “Candidate Login” button. Next, select the test number from the drop-down menu, enter the application number, password and security pin. Click on the “Sign-In” button to submit the details. On submitting the login details, in the next screen, candidates need to click on the relevant link for downloading the Admit Card. Lastly, take a print out of the CET Delhi 2019 Admit Card.

CET Delhi 2019 Admit Card

The admit card consist of personal details of the candidate as well as exam details like candidate’s name, date of birth, category, gender photo & signature of the candidate, exam date, timings, reporting timings, address of the test center, etc.

The state-level polytechnic exam Delhi Common Entrance Test or also popular as Delhi Polytechnic Exam is scheduled to be conducted on June 8 and 9, 2019. On the day of the test, candidates need to carry a print out of the Delhi CET Admit Card, Aadhaar Card/ School or Institute Identity card and a black ballpoint pen.

Delhi CET 2019 examination is going to be conducted in two shifts. The first shift is from 9:15 am to 12:30 pm and the second shift is from 1:15 pm to 4:30 pm. The question paper for CET Delhi 2019 consist of 150 Objective type questions and each question has 4 marks. The result for the Delhi CET or Polytechnic Examination is going to be declared on June 21, 2019.

The entrance exam is held to offer admission to different full-time diploma courses in the field of engineering, pharmacy, technology, etc. Many government and private polytechnic colleges in Delhi give admission on the basis of CET Delhi scores.

Department of Training and Technical Education (DTTE) imparts technical education and technological skills through various courses of study at different levels. Full-time Diploma Courses in Engineering / Technology, Occupational, and ITI /Secretarial/management based disciplines are offered at different AICTE approved Government Institutes.
